#b3d538 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b3d538 is composed of 70.2% red, 83.5% green and 22%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 16% cyan, 0% magenta, 73.7% yellow and 16.5% black. It has a hue angle of 73 degrees, a saturation of 65.1% and a lightness of 52.7%. #b3d538 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ff70 with #67ab00. Closest websafe color is: #cccc33.

#b3d538 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b3d538 has RGB values of R:179, G:213, B:56 and CMYK values of C:0.16, M:0, Y:0.74,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 11785528.

Shades and Tints of #b3d538
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0c02 is the darkest color, while #fdfefa is the lightest one.

Tones of #b3d538
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#898b82 is the less saturated color, while #c8fa13 is the most saturated one.
